1550nm transceivers and multi-mode fiber
m4rtin
According to
Cisco Small Form-Factor Pluggable Modules for Gigabit Ethernet Applications Data Sheet
, 1310nm
1000BASE-LX/LH
transceivers work fine with 62.5/125µm(OM1) and 50/125µm(OM[234]) multi-mode cables. However, which distances might one expect in practice? According to Cisco one might expect 550m when using 1310nm 1000BASE-LX/LH trasnceivers. In addition, has anyone seen a paper/article which exactly explains why 1000BASE-ZX(1550nm) transceivers do not work with multi-mode fiber(it's probably because of total internal reflection)?
